Pocono flute camp

SOLD OUT!  We have filled all of our openings for summer 2025. If you were planning to attend but hadn't registered yet, we will keep a wait list in case of cancellations. Contact martasgig@aol.com.


A flute camp designed for adult amateur flute players and flute hobbyists held on the beautiful campus of Marywood University in Scranton, PA.Enrollment will be limited to adults age 18 and up. Join other flute lovers for a week of workshops, chamber music, and flute instruction in a non-competitive atmosphere. Led by energetic and talented flutists, the daily workshops will give every amateur flutist a great basis for continuing their flute studies.  Each attendee will also have the opportunity for lessons with the clinicians. All housing, breakfast, classes and rehearsals will be held in a single building on the Marywood campus. Meals will be in the college dining hall just a short distance from the dorm.

sample daily schedule

8:00-9:00  Breakfast

9:00-10:00  Class on general interest topic

10:00-12:00  Flute choir rehearsal

12:00-1:00  Lunch break

1:00-3:00  Small ensemble rehearsals and coaching

3:00-5:00  Lessons with camp clinicians and recreation time

5:00-6:30  Dinner

Evenings - Recreation time on Monday and Tuesday, clinician recital on Wednesday, 

                    camper recital on Thursday

Camper recital

Campers will have the opportunity to work with an accompanist and perform on a camper recital, if they wish. Solos, duets and trios, with or without accompaniment may be prepared. Those campers who would rather be audience members are also welcome!

placement recording

In order to assign chamber music groups and flute choir parts campers need to send a recording of their playing at registration time.
